Director Agriculture reviews Annual Action Plan 2026–27 and infrastructure projects in Jammu

Stresses timely execution of projects, efficient fund utilisation and field monitoring

JAMMU, JUNE 17 (PTK): Director Agriculture Jammu, Anil Gupta, today chaired a review meeting at the Conference Hall of the Directorate of Agriculture Jammu to assess preparedness and implementation strategy for the Annual Action Plan (AAP) 2026–27 and review the status of infrastructural and developmental projects across the Jammu Division.

The meeting deliberated on district-wise targets, priorities and implementation modalities under various schemes included in the Annual Action Plan 2026–27, besides reviewing the physical and financial progress achieved so far.

The Director also reviewed the tendering process for CAPEX, Holistic Agriculture Development Programme (HADP) and NABARD-funded projects and took stock of infrastructure projects established under HADP, JKCIP, Centrally Sponsored Schemes (CSS) and CAPEX across the division.

Anil Gupta directed the concerned officers to ensure efficient utilisation of funds, strict adherence to project timelines and close monitoring of ongoing works to expedite pending activities and achieve the targets set for the current financial year.

He further underscored the importance of regular field monitoring, effective coordination among stakeholders and prompt resolution of bottlenecks to enhance the impact of agricultural development programmes across Jammu Division.
